A podcast for multi-passionate creatives and serial entrepreneurs building six-figure, pivot-proof businesses. Hosted by brand strategist Kristen and neurodivergent entrepreneur Mia, the show covers personal branding, ADHD, perimenopause, content creation, monetisation, digital products, and brand partnership deals. Each week offers strategy, lived experience, and mindset work for women 40+ and neurodivergent entrepreneurs.
